Quaero, LLC to Conduct Second CRM Workshop for The Direct Marketing Association in New York City

Interactive Program Combines Strategy and Tactics for Powerful Real-world Learning

Charlotte, NC - September 12, 2000 - Quaero, LLC, a leading provider of 1:1 e-marketing infrastructure and programs, today announced it will be conducting two more three-day CRM workshops this year on behalf of The Direct Marketing Association (DMA). The next workshop will be held September 18-20 at the DMA Seminar Center in New York City. The final workshop is scheduled for November 1-3 at the Palmer House Hilton in Chicago. Unlike other high-level CRM programs, The DMA workshop led by Quaero is highly interactive and covers CRM from both a strategic and tactical perspective. This approach creates a real-world learning experience, which reinforces the concepts taught during the training, long after the session has ended. Participants come away with a complete solution-oriented plan that they can implement immediately.

During the workshop attendees will learn how to:

· Spot new trends for individual customers and customer segments

· Develop selling and loyalty capabilities across all customer touch points

· Tear down walls between marketing, technology, sales and service

· Select and implement CRM technology that meets your company’s unique requirements

· Develop a business case to convince the organization to adopt CRM

• Blend customer value and financial value metrics

About The DMA

The DMA is the leading and largest trade association for businesses interested in interactive and database marketing, with nearly 5,000 member companies from the United States and 53 other nations. Founded in 1917, its members include direct marketers from every business segment as well as the nonprofit and electronic marketing sectors. Included are catalogers, Internet retailers and service providers, financial services providers, book and magazine publishers, book and music clubs, retail stores, industrial manufacturers and a host of other vertical segments including the service industries that support them. About Quaero, LLC

Quaero designs, develops and deploys effective 1:1 e-marketing programs using the confluence of technology, analytics and marketing expertise for Fortune 1000 and Internet 100 companies. Quaero addresses the needs of Internet and traditional companies to translate their customer contacts into long-term profitable relationships. Quaero helps businesses in financial services, retail, communications and health care, translate customer data into effective Customer Relationship Management (CRM) programs by developing and deploying large scale customer intelligence infrastructure for effective personalized interactions for customer acquisition, retention and expansion. Clients include priceline.com, Sallie Mae, SciQuest.com, Merck-Medco Managed Care, LLC and The Limited, Inc..
